Top Tac Computers | Reviews & Ratings | vimarsana.com

Tac computers in India - 312605 / Supermarket near Pratapgarh near Pratapgarh

Tac computers in Puerto rico - 33169 / Computer-service near Miami-dade

Tac computers in United states - 56232 / Computer-products near Dawson